Answer:
The following are the conditions:
• Each trial must be independent;
i.e., the outcome of one trial cannot affect the outcome of another.
• Probability of success must be constant;
i.e., the probability of success of each trial must be the same.
• Number of trials (n) must be finite.
• Trials must have only two possible outcomes (i.e., success and failure)

What is the value of sin(80%)cos(20°) - cos(80°)sin(20°)?
Answer:
\(\frac{\sqrt{3} }{2}\)
Step-by-step explanation:
edge 2020
The value of sin(80) cos(20°) - cos(80°) sin(20°)= √3/2
What is Trigonometry?Trigonometry the area of mathematics that deals with particular angles' functions and how to use those functions in calculations. There are six common trigonometric functions for an angle. Sine (sin), cosine (cos), tangent (tan), cotangent (cot), secant (sec), and cosecant are their respective names and abbreviations.
Given:
sin(80) cos(20°) - cos(80°) sin(20°)
Using Trigonometric identity
sin ( A- B) = sin A cos B - cos A sin B
So, sin(80) cos(20°) - cos(80°) sin(20°)
= sin (80 - 20)
= sin 60
= √3/2
Hence, sin(80) cos(20°) - cos(80°) sin(20°)= √3/2

If r objects are being selected from a group of n distinct objects and order does matter, then this arrangement is known as a
Answer:
Permutation
Step-by-step explanation:
The term to describe the given statement is permutation.
When defining permutation, certain keywords such as order does matter and arrangement are used to describe permutation.
Take for instance:
The arrangement of 3 boys on a seat
Ways 4 friends can sit to take photographs
...are examples of permutation
Permutation of r objects in n distinct objects is calculated as:
\(^nP_r = \frac{n!}{(n -r)!}\)
